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
14206227457 5832219553 5321981 568892 2359349
280593 9351118627
280593 9351118627
5271050 6357034 94765422831
All about undefined
Interested in learning more?
280593 9351118627
5271050 6357034 94765422831
See more
63887738 55598576
7427115 3256 91 257839409
See more
32 12348882376 7598
66053864 01381 73435 179
See more